>Number: 5436 >Category: mod_jserv >Synopsis: ApacheJServ-1.1b3 configure script tries to check for RH 6.1, >but the string it looks for is incorrect >Confidential: no >Severity: non-critical >Priority: medium >Responsible: jserv >State: open >Class: sw-bug >Submitter-Id: apache >Arrival-Date: Tue Dec 7 10:50:00 PST 1999 >Last-Modified: >Originator: [EMAIL PROTECTED] >Organization: apache >Release: 1.3.9 >Environment: RedHat 6.1 Linux d185fce69.rochester.rr.com 2.2.12-20 #1 Mon Sep 27 10:40:35 EDT 1999 i686 unknown >Description: When running configure from ApacheJServ-1.1b3 distro on RedHat 6.1, the script incorrectly fails (doesn't hit code meant to be run to give a descriptive error message):
>How-To-Repeat: >Fix: Line 3305 should have "modules" and not "module". Corrected version: if ${TEST} "${libexecdir}" = "modules" ; then >Audit-Trail: >Unformatted: [In order for any reply to be added to the PR database, you need] [to include <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> in the Cc line and make sure the] [subject line starts with the report component and number, with ] [or without any 'Re:' prefixes (such as "general/1098:" or ] ["Re: general/1098:").
